'Clime' definitions:

Definition of 'clime'

(from WordNet)
noun
The weather in some location averaged over some long period of time; "the dank climate of southern Wales"; "plants from a cold clime travel best in winter" [syn: climate, clime]

Definition of 'Clime'

From: GCIDE
  • Clime \Clime\, n. [L. clima. See Climate.] A climate; a tract or region of the earth. See Climate. [1913 Webster]
  • Turn we to sutvey, Where rougher climes a nobler race display. --Goldsmith. [1913 Webster]
